Output b78aeb8f43cc7e02f3968ca4f20c79a05f5daaa6bd2a5afb80815abc201ea46d:0

value
19069766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c878cc52479b100730c061c2630052635d350a OP_EQUAL
address
33aubQjENrquLSJBvmdH4m9XMYcFNL2TLV
transaction
b78aeb8f43cc7e02f3968ca4f20c79a05f5daaa6bd2a5afb80815abc201ea46d
confirmations
316508
spent
true